4 Playback Viewer
To open the Playback Viewer program, double-click the
Playback Viewer icon on your desktop. Alternatively,
click the icon in the Live Viewer program. The
Playback Viewer program can only work with one
DVR at a time. Click to log into the DVR.
To open the Live Viewer program from the Playback
Viewer program click the Live Viewer program icon
at the bottom of the screen.
To guarantee performance, Playback Viewer access is
limited to two remote users.
4.1 Search
4.1.1 Timeline overview
The bottom of the screen shows a timeline with
information on the playback video. Blue indicates that
there are recordings. Red indicates Input Alarm
recording and yellow indicates Motion Alarm
recording. Light blue indicates no recordings.

4.1.4 Calendar search
Click to open the calandar pop-up
window. Select a date and time. Click GO to display
recorded video from that date and time.
4.1.5 Event search
1. Click .
> The event list shows all events.
2. To see specific types of event, select the type in the
drop-down list.
> Event types are ALL, MOTION, INPUT ALARM and TEXT.
3. Double-click an event.
> Playback of the event starts.
4.1.6 Text search
1. Click the text button to open a window which
displays the text from a text device.
2. Click the Save button.
> Text is saved to the designated directory as a .txt file.
